Transaction 708674818da89652cc68989305abd7ad811ad00c6fa609fe09ba8480edf57378

3 Input
2 Outputs
  • 708674818da89652cc68989305abd7ad811ad00c6fa609fe09ba8480edf57378:0
  • value  1590
    address  1JiPUr4yjonyd47vEbjqw66N5cgJqEWb7n
  • 708674818da89652cc68989305abd7ad811ad00c6fa609fe09ba8480edf57378:1
  • value  636112
    address  19ogwuuPWi3SRhgMh8UgEHgiFjpFtker1R